Question: What is the average lifespan of an American Pit Bull Terrier?

Answer: American Pit Bull Terriers typically live between 12 to 16 years. This lifespan can be influenced by factors like diet, exercise, and genetic health. Regular vet check-ups and a balanced diet are crucial for their longevity.

Question: How much exercise does an American Pit Bull Terrier need?

Answer: American Pit Bull Terriers are high-energy dogs that require at least 60 minutes of vigorous exercise daily. This can include activities like brisk walking, running, and interactive play. Lack of exercise can lead to behavioral issues due to pent-up energy.

Question: Are American Pit Bull Terriers naturally aggressive?

Answer: No, American Pit Bull Terriers are not inherently aggressive. Like any breed, their temperament is shaped by upbringing, training, and socialization. With proper training and socialization, they are known to be friendly and loyal companions.

Question: Is it true that American Pit Bull Terriers have locking jaws?

Answer: No, the myth that American Pit Bull Terriers have locking jaws is false. They have strong jaws like many other breeds, but there is no unique mechanism that enables them to lock their jaws.

Question: What are the common health issues in American Pit Bull Terriers?

Answer: Common health issues include hip dysplasia, allergies, and heart diseases. Regular health check-ups, a nutritious diet, and adequate exercise can help mitigate these risks.

Question: Are American Pit Bull Terriers good with children?

Answer: American Pit Bull Terriers can be great with children if they are properly trained and socialized from a young age. They are known for their loyalty and affection towards family members, including kids.

Question: How much grooming do American Pit Bull Terriers require?

Answer: They have a short, low-maintenance coat that requires minimal grooming. Regular brushing, occasional baths, and routine nail trimming are sufficient to keep them clean and healthy.

Question: Can American Pit Bull Terriers be trained easily?

Answer: Yes, American Pit Bull Terriers are intelligent and eager to please, making them relatively easy to train. Consistency, positive reinforcement, and early socialization are key to effective training.

Question: What is the average weight and height of an American Pit Bull Terrier?

Answer: Male American Pit Bull Terriers usually weigh between 35 to 65 pounds (16 to 29 kilograms) and stand about 18 to 21 inches (45 to 53 centimeters) tall. Females are slightly smaller, typically weighing 30 to 60 pounds (14 to 27 kilograms) and standing 17 to 20 inches (43 to 50 centimeters) tall.

Question: Do American Pit Bull Terriers make good apartment pets?

Answer: While they can adapt to apartment living, American Pit Bull Terriers thrive best with access to a yard for exercise. If living in an apartment, owners should ensure regular exercise and mental stimulation to keep them happy and healthy.
